pc: Extract CPU lookup into a separate function
It will be reused in the next patch at pre_plug time Signed-off-by: Igor Mammedov <imammedo@redhat.com> Reviewed-by: Eduardo Habkost <ehabkost@redhat.com> Signed-off-by: Eduardo Habkost <ehabkost@redhat.com>

+/* returns pointer to CPUArchId descriptor that matches CPU's apic_id
+ * in pcms->possible_cpus->cpus, if pcms->possible_cpus->cpus has no
+ * entry correponding to CPU's apic_id returns NULL.
+ */
+static CPUArchId *pc_find_cpu_slot(PCMachineState *pcms, CPUState *cpu,
+ int *idx)
+{
+ CPUClass *cc = CPU_GET_CLASS(cpu);
+ CPUArchId apic_id, *found_cpu;
+
+ apic_id.arch_id = cc->get_arch_id(CPU(cpu));
+ found_cpu = bsearch(&apic_id, pcms->possible_cpus->cpus,
+ pcms->possible_cpus->len, sizeof(*pcms->possible_cpus->cpus),
+ pc_apic_cmp);
+ if (found_cpu && idx) {
+ *idx = found_cpu - pcms->possible_cpus->cpus;
+ }
+ return found_cpu;
+}
